How EDI Supports Better Demand Forecasting and Inventory Planning

October 16, 2024
Effective demand forecasting and inventory planning are essential for meeting customer expectations and reducing operational costs. Electronic Data Interchange (EDI) supports these processes by providing accurate, real-time data, allowing businesses to predict demand more accurately and optimize inventory levels. This article explores how EDI improves forecasting and inventory management.
Providing Real-Time Data for Accurate Forecasting
EDI enables the seamless exchange of sales and inventory data between suppliers and retailers. This real-time data provides businesses with insights into customer buying patterns, allowing them to adjust forecasts based on actual demand and trends, leading to more precise inventory planning.
Reducing Stockouts and Overstocks
With up-to-date inventory data, EDI helps businesses avoid stockouts and overstocks by aligning inventory levels with demand forecasts. By ensuring that the right products are available when needed, EDI reduces the risk of lost sales and minimizes the need for costly markdowns.
Optimizing Supply Chain Efficiency
EDI enhances supply chain efficiency by improving coordination with suppliers. Real-time data allows businesses to adjust orders and production schedules based on forecasted demand, ensuring that inventory levels remain balanced and aligned with customer needs.
Key Benefits of EDI for Forecasting and Inventory Planning
Issue | How EDI Helps |
---|---|
Stockouts | Provides real-time stock visibility for timely replenishment. |
Overstocks | Helps businesses adjust orders based on demand trends. |
Delayed Shipments | Enables faster supplier coordination to prevent order delays. |

How does EDI help with inventory management?
EDI helps businesses by automating stock updates, providing real-time tracking, and ensuring inventory levels align with demand, reducing both stockouts and overstock issues.
Can EDI improve demand forecasting?
Yes, EDI provides accurate, up-to-date inventory data, enabling businesses to predict demand based on actual sales trends, leading to more efficient inventory planning.
